As I near the end of Phase 1 flight test I had a couple of tasks to take care of in preparation for flying away from home base. Namely trial fitting the travel cover and fabricating a set of travel chocks.
More than a year after receiving it from Bruce's aircraft covers I finally got a chance to trial fit my travel cover on the airplane. It fits great and is of excellent quality.
I also fabricated a set of wheel chocks from 3/4 inch PVC pipe. These are small enough to fit under the low wheel pants on the RV-8 although I did have to trim a little off of the aft leg of both for clearance. They'll be carried in the airplane for use when parking at airports other than home base since the typical chocks found at airport parking areas are much too large for RV wheel pants.
